dc.description We review the role of the QCD vacuum structure in the determination of the properties of states and processes occurring in the confinement regime of QCD. The vacuum correlation model of non-perturbative QCD is mentioned as a bridge between the fundamental theory and the description of the experiments. The model of the stochastic vacuum provides the framework in which a simple and effective description of the high-energy pp and p data can be given, leading to a determination of relevant parameters of non-perturbative QCD and to a good description of the data. A slow increase of the hadronic radii with the energy accounts for the energy dependence of all observables.
